Exemple #1
0
        private void button23_Click(object sender, EventArgs e)
        {
            //all ships
            StringBuilder strResult = new StringBuilder(5000);

            int nCities = BUSCity.Count();

            for (int i = 0; i < nCities; i++)
            {
                strResult.Append("---Town: " +
                                 BUSCity.GetCity(i).Name
                                 + "---\r\n");
                BUSTroops.ForceUpdateShips(i);
                int nTroops = BUSTroops.CountShips(BUSCity.GetCurrentCity());
                for (int j = 0; j < nTroops; j++)
                {
                    DTOTroops troop = BUSTroops.GetShipsInCity(i, j);

                    strResult.Append("  " + troop.Type);
                    strResult.Append(" " + troop.Quality);
                    strResult.Append(" is unit: " + troop.IsUnits);
                    strResult.Append("\r\n");
                }
            }

            tbResult.Text = strResult.ToString();
        }
        static DTOTroops GetUnitAndTroop(HtmlNode node,
                                         DTOTroops.TYPE type,
                                         bool bIsUnits)
        {
            DTOTroops troop = new DTOTroops();

            troop.Type    = type;
            troop.IsUnits = bIsUnits;
            //string strTemp = node.InnerText;
            //strTemp = strTemp.Replace(",", "");
            //strTemp = strTemp.Replace("-", "");
            //troop.Quality = int.Parse(strTemp);
            troop.Quality = NodeParser.toInt(node.InnerText);

            return(troop);
        }
Exemple #3
0
        private void button14_Click(object sender, EventArgs e)
        {
            //get ship
            StringBuilder strResult = new StringBuilder(1000);

            int nTroops = BUSTroops.CountShips(BUSCity.GetCurrentCity());

            for (int i = 0; i < nTroops; i++)
            {
                DTOTroops troop = BUSTroops.GetShipsInCity(BUSCity.GetCurrentCity(), i);

                strResult.Append("  " + troop.Type);
                strResult.Append(" " + troop.Quality);
                strResult.Append(" is unit: " + troop.IsUnits);
                strResult.Append("\r\n");
            }

            tbResult.Text = strResult.ToString();
        }